Market Overview

ECG Stress Test Market size was valued at USD 2.7 billion in 2024 and is anticipated to reach USD 4.84 billion by 2032, growing at a CAGR of 7.6% during the forecast period.

Market Segmentation Analysis:

By Product Type

Exercise testing systems dominate the ECG Stress Test Market with a share of over 38% in 2024. These systems are preferred for their ability to provide accurate cardiac performance data under controlled physical stress, essential for diagnosing coronary artery diseases. The integration of advanced sensors, wireless connectivity, and AI-based data interpretation enhances test efficiency and accuracy. Stress ECG systems follow closely, supported by growing demand for portable and digital solutions in outpatient settings. Increasing prevalence of cardiovascular disorders and a shift toward preventive diagnostics further drive segment growth.

  • For instance, GE Healthcare’s CASE Cardiac Assessment System offers advanced analysis of patient risk and functional responses during exercise testing, enhancing workflow productivity through digital connectivity.

By End Use

Hospitals lead the ECG Stress Test Market with a share exceeding 45% in 2024, attributed to their comprehensive diagnostic infrastructure and skilled personnel. Hospitals adopt advanced exercise testing systems and stress ECG equipment to ensure early detection and effective cardiac assessment. Diagnostic centers represent a growing segment as affordability and outpatient cardiac care expand in urban areas. Ambulatory surgical centers also contribute steadily with rising adoption of compact and mobile diagnostic tools. Increasing healthcare expenditure and focus on cardiovascular disease management support hospital segment dominance.

  • For instance, Norav Medical offers wireless and wired Stress ECG systems tailored for hospital cardiology departments, such as the 1200W with Bluetooth-enabled mobility for precise diagnostics.

Key Growth Drivers

Rising Prevalence of Cardiovascular Diseases

The increasing incidence of cardiovascular diseases remains the strongest growth catalyst for the ECG Stress Test Market. Sedentary lifestyles, obesity, and aging populations have escalated cardiac disorder cases worldwide. As a result, hospitals and diagnostic centers prioritize early detection through stress testing systems. The need for accurate assessment of heart performance under controlled exertion continues to expand. Government health initiatives and growing public awareness about preventive cardiac care further boost demand for ECG stress testing equipment globally.

  • For instance, Mortara Instrument, a key player in diagnostic cardiology, offers advanced ECG stress test systems known for accuracy and ease of use, widely adopted by hospitals globally to enhance early cardiac evaluation.

Technological Advancements in Diagnostic Equipment

Technological innovation is transforming cardiac diagnostics with smarter, more efficient systems. AI-based ECG interpretation, wireless sensors, and real-time monitoring enhance accuracy and speed. Portable and wearable devices improve patient comfort and enable remote testing. Manufacturers are integrating automation and cloud-based data storage to streamline workflow and reduce manual errors. These advancements increase diagnostic precision while expanding accessibility across hospitals, diagnostic centers, and ambulatory care facilities, reinforcing the market’s upward growth trajectory.

  • For instance, PMcardio’s AI-powered ECG interpretation app delivers up to twice the sensitivity in detecting heart attacks compared to standard care, reducing false cath lab activations and unnecessary procedures.

Growing Emphasis on Preventive Healthcare

A global shift toward preventive healthcare drives continuous adoption of ECG stress testing. Health systems promote early screening to reduce the burden of advanced cardiac disease and associated treatment costs. High-risk populations—such as diabetics and elderly individuals—undergo regular cardiac evaluations using stress test systems. Supportive reimbursement frameworks and preventive health campaigns further enhance testing volumes. This proactive approach fosters steady demand for reliable, accurate, and cost-effective ECG stress testing devices across healthcare networks.

Key Trends & Opportunities

Integration of AI and Remote Monitoring Solutions

The fusion of artificial intelligence and remote monitoring technologies is redefining ECG stress testing. AI algorithms enable precise detection of cardiac abnormalities and automated data interpretation. Remote and cloud-connected devices allow real-time performance tracking and physician access beyond hospital settings. Manufacturers are developing telehealth-compatible ECG systems to meet the rising demand for virtual diagnostics. This shift toward smart connectivity opens new avenues for patient-centered cardiac care and market expansion.

  • For instance, Tempus has received FDA Breakthrough Device Designation for its AI-powered ECG Analysis Platform, which automatically analyzes 12-lead ECGs to identify patients at increased risk of atrial fibrillation within a year, supporting early diagnosis and intervention.

Rising Adoption of Portable and Wireless Devices

Growing preference for portable and wireless ECG systems marks a key market trend. Compact stress testing devices support quick setup, mobility, and enhanced patient comfort. Healthcare providers in remote or resource-limited areas benefit from these systems’ flexibility and lower operational costs. The trend aligns with the increasing decentralization of cardiac diagnostics and the growth of home-based healthcare services. Manufacturers investing in lightweight, Bluetooth-enabled models are gaining competitive advantage in this evolving landscape.

  • For instance, AliveCor’s KardiaMobile 6L is a Bluetooth-enabled, six-lead portable ECG device that captures medical-grade heart data in just 30 seconds, providing flexibility for remote monitoring and home use.

Key Challenges

High Equipment and Maintenance Costs

The high initial cost of advanced ECG stress test systems poses a barrier to market growth. Smaller healthcare facilities and diagnostic centers often face financial constraints in upgrading to modern technologies. Maintenance expenses, calibration needs, and staff training add to operational costs. These financial challenges restrict access in developing economies and rural healthcare settings. Addressing cost-effectiveness through local manufacturing and public health partnerships remains critical to improving affordability and market penetration.

Limited Skilled Professionals and Operational Complexity

The operation of ECG stress testing equipment requires trained cardiologists and technicians. A shortage of skilled professionals limits effective deployment, particularly in emerging markets. Complex device interfaces and interpretation of test results demand specialized training. Inadequate expertise may result in diagnostic inaccuracies and workflow inefficiencies. Manufacturers and healthcare institutions are focusing on simplified interfaces, AI-assisted diagnostics, and structured training programs to bridge this skill gap and ensure consistent, high-quality testing outcomes.

Regional Analysis

North America

North America dominates the ECG Stress Test Market with a share of 36% in 2024, driven by advanced healthcare infrastructure and strong diagnostic adoption. The U.S. leads the region due to high cardiovascular disease prevalence and widespread use of AI-integrated testing systems. Supportive reimbursement policies and government programs promoting preventive cardiac screening further enhance market expansion. Canada shows steady growth supported by technological upgrades in hospitals and diagnostic centers. Continuous investments in medical device innovation sustain the region’s leadership in the global ECG stress testing landscape.

Europe

Europe holds a market share of 28% in 2024, supported by strong regulatory frameworks and emphasis on early cardiac diagnosis. Countries such as Germany, France, and the U.K. invest heavily in hospital-based diagnostic technologies and preventive healthcare programs. The presence of major medical device manufacturers and increasing adoption of portable stress testing systems drive market performance. Favorable healthcare reimbursement and rising public awareness about heart health contribute to growth. Expanding digital health infrastructure and ongoing modernization of healthcare systems sustain Europe’s position as a major regional market.

Asia Pacific

Asia Pacific accounts for 24% of the global ECG Stress Test Market in 2024, emerging as the fastest-growing region. Rapid urbanization, growing cardiac disease burden, and expanding healthcare infrastructure fuel demand for advanced testing equipment. China, Japan, and India lead adoption, supported by government initiatives promoting preventive cardiac care. Local manufacturing, cost-effective devices, and increasing investments in hospital diagnostics further stimulate growth. Rising disposable income and improved access to healthcare services position Asia Pacific as a key region for future market expansion and innovation.

Latin America

Latin America represents a market share of 7% in 2024, driven by expanding access to cardiac diagnostics across urban centers. Brazil and Mexico lead the region due to improving healthcare infrastructure and public health campaigns targeting cardiovascular disease. Adoption of compact and affordable ECG stress testing systems grows among mid-sized hospitals and diagnostic clinics. Economic recovery and rising private healthcare investments encourage gradual modernization of diagnostic facilities. However, limited reimbursement frameworks and uneven healthcare distribution restrain the pace of market development across rural areas.

Middle East & Africa

The Middle East & Africa region captures a market share of 5% in 2024, with steady adoption of ECG stress testing systems in developed Gulf countries. Saudi Arabia, the UAE, and South Africa drive demand through hospital modernization and public health initiatives targeting cardiac disorders. Investments in telehealth and remote monitoring solutions enhance access to advanced diagnostics. However, limited healthcare infrastructure and affordability issues in several African nations constrain broader adoption. Ongoing government efforts to improve healthcare access are expected to support moderate market growth.

Recent Developments

  • In June 2024, AliveCor, Inc. launched its Kardia 12L ECG System, featuring dual FDA clearance and advanced 12-lead ECG capability that provides 35 cardiac determinations for improved diagnostic accuracy.
  • In July 2025, Royal Philips launched its ECG AI Marketplace, giving cardiac care teams access to vendor-agnostic AI tools through Philips’ ECG ecosystem. The first integrated algorithm from Anumana supports early detection of low ejection fraction.
  • In June 2025, GE HealthCare unveiled its enhanced cardiac diagnostics portfolio at the SNMMI 2025 conference, emphasizing improved molecular imaging and connectivity solutions to strengthen stress testing and cardiac analysis capabilities.
